Will i lose data on my 2 volumes if i reset the DNS321 device ?
Title: Re: Reset and Data
Post by: gunrunnerjohn on March 03, 2010, 03:20:49 PM
The official D-Link answer is no, and I've reset both the DNS-321 and DNS-323 with no data loss.

Of course, you should have a backup of any data on the unit anyway...
